What is FatRat?

FatRat is a feature rich download manager written in C++ and built on top of Qt4 library. It supports a lot of download and file exchange protocols and is continuously extended. It also includes a plugin system.

Fatrat App Features

  • HTTP(S)/FTP downloads
  • FTP uploads
  • RSS feed support + special functions for TV shows and podcasts
  • BitTorrent support (including torrent creating, DHT, UPnP, encryption etc.)
  • Torrent search
  • Support for SOCKS5 and HTTP proxies
  • RapidSafe link decoding
  • MD4/MD5/SHA1 hash computing
  • Remote control via Jabber
  • Remote control via a web interface
  • YouTube video downloading

Install FatRat on Ubuntu

Open the terminal and run the following command

sudo apt-get install fatrat
